Brick Rigs has a steep learning curve and complex controls that initially hinder enjoyment, but once mastered, the game offers rewarding building mechanics and fun multiplayer experiences, especially with friends.
Reported time to anchor: 2h.
Friction: Steep learning curve; Complex and unintuitive controls; Lack of clear tutorials.
Unlock drivers: Tutorials; Community help; Practice and experience.

The game generally performs well across different hardware configurations, with most players reporting smooth gameplay and high frame rates, even on lower-end systems.
Windows <8GB VRAM / <16GB RAM: positive. Players report smooth gameplay and high FPS, even on lower-end systems with maxed-out graphics settings.
Windows <8GB VRAM / 16-31GB RAM: positive. Players experience minimal lag and infrequent crashes, indicating good performance.
Steam Deck: The game faces significant issues on the Steam Deck, including poor optimization and compatibility problems on Linux, complex and unintuitive controls, and misleading verification claims. Users often need to employ workarounds to play the game, which detracts from the overall experience.
Linux and Proton: The game experiences significant issues with launching on Linux, as reported by multiple users. While it works fine on Steam Deck, the overall Linux support appears to be problematic.
